About this game

Inching Along is a physics-based game where you control a floppy little inchworm trying to navigate a large and uncaring world.

Movement is entirely physics-driven: you grab onto surfaces with either end of your body and swing, inch, and pull yourself along using momentum and torque, one inch at a time. There are no upgrades or powerups, progress comes from improving your understanding of the mechanics, and a pinch of persistence 🐛

Gameplay Features

  • Physics-driven movement.

  • A single continuous world with no loading screens. Journey seamlessly through multiple themed areas as you climb.

  • Checkpoints for saving your progress.

  • Skill-based progression, no character levels or powerups.

  • Slow, deliberate movement focused on momentum and precision

What to Expect

  • Exploration and traversal challenges based on physics interaction

  • A test of patience, timing, and persistence

  • Minimal UI and storytelling, with a focus on atmosphere and discovery
